Louisiana Pacific Gains the most, but Stocks mostly Quiet

Investors hit the pause button as investors took a breather, as the three major indexes ended up slightly lower in today’s trading. CNNMoney reports the Dow nudged down -27.48 points, -0.17 percent, to end the day at 16,179.66. The Nasdaq moved down -5.38 points, -0.13 percent, to finish at 4,287.59, while the S&P slipped -2.49 points, -0.13 percent, to close at 1,845.12. The Yahoo! Finance Manufactured Housing Composite gained +0.70 percent to close at 757.88. Housing stocks we track in today’s trading closed mixed or even, but Louisiana Pacific Industries gained the most in today’s trading, moving up +2.07 percent, +0.37 points, to close at 18.22, while Patrick Industries nudged down the most, losing -1.16 percent, -0.49 points, to finish at 41.93.
